Solution Overview
Problem
Existing methods for configuring Internet Protocol (IP) addresses in computer networks often result in administrators needing to manually configure devices, which is time-consuming and requires detailed knowledge, especially when physical access is limited or network access is unavailable, due to issues with DHCP reservations, static IP configurations, and lack of Ethernet ports.
Innovation Solution
A method and apparatus for activating IP configurations by detecting direct IP connections between nodes and maintaining separate IP configurations for communication, allowing automatic switching to a suitable configuration upon detection of a direct connection, using an IP connection detector and IP configuration manager.

Methods and arrangements for activating Internet Protocol (IP) configurations are discussed. Embodiments include transformations, code, state machines or other logic for activating in an end node an IP configuration suitable for IP communications between the end node and another end node upon the detection of a direct IP connection of the end node to another end node. In some embodiments, the other end node may have a direct IP connect only to the end node. In some embodiments, the suitable IP configuration may involve a static IP address which has been published. In some embodiments, detecting a direct IP connection with another node may be accomplished by detecting a crossed-over Ethernet connection. In some embodiments, an operating system device driver may activate the suitable IP configuration. In other embodiments, an embedded system may activate the suitable IP configuration.
